James Precise

ROSSVILLE James Robert Precise, 89, went home to be with his Lord and Savior on Friday, May 18, 2012. He was born in Scottsboro, Ala. to the late, Rorex & Mae Belle Precise, but had lived in the Rossville area for most of his life and was Ordained into the Baptist Ministry in 1959. He was previously employed with Peerless-Woolen Mills and was a member of Battlefield Baptist Church. He also enjoyed fishing and was a wonderful father, husband and grandfather who will be greatly missed by all that knew him. He was also preceded in death by his wife, Lela Mae Precise; son, Bobby Precise; great granddaughter, Sara Maynor; two sisters, Rena Proctor and Hazel Floyd and brother, Lloyd Bryan Precise.Survivors include his two daughters & son-in-law, Glenda & (Howard) Thomas and Janet Kanitz all of Rossville, Ga.; sister, Sally Proctor of Scottsboro, Ala.; 6 grandchildren, Larry & Tommy Maynor and James, Tracy, Randy & Tammy Hicks; 20 great grandchildren; 6 great great grandchildren and several nieces and nephews.Funeral services will be held at 12 p.m. today, May 21, in the Fort Oglethorpe Chapel with Rev. David Crane officiating. Burial will follow in the Tennessee-Georgia Memorial Park. The family will receive friends after 3 p.m. Sunday and prior to the service on today at the funeral home. Arrangements by W. L. Wilson & Sons Funeral Homes, Fort Oglethorpe, Ga.
